Urban Meyer hints JT Barrett leads Ohio State starting QB competition

Urban Meyer likes to conceal his plans from the media and even went as far as to deny Braxton Miller was switching positions when the story first went public. But he may have tipped his hand regarding his plans for his starting quarterback.

Meyer spoke at Big Ten Media Days on Thursday and was asked about Ohio State’s starting QB competition, which is between J.T. Barrett and Cardale Jones now that Miller is switching to H-Back. Meyer responded by saying the Buckeyes keep track of everything and have even been grading the players based on leadership displayed over the summer.
